NOT A WRONG'UN: Why Shane Warne will be Rajasthan Royals' coach-cum-mentor for 2018 IPL

SHANE WARNE was a magician with the ball. Off the field too, he remains a charmer. However, when it comes to making an announcement or expressing his views on the game, he doesn't mince words. Just like he did on Sunday morning on Twitter. 

The legendary leggie declared,

"Looking forward to making an announcement to you guys this week which I'm very excited about & yes it involves the #IPL2018!," 

While many might speculate his role with the IPL for the forthcoming season, we at TFG are convinced that Warne will eventually end up being the coach-cum-mentor for the Royals. It's just a matter of time before he makes it official. 

Remember, in 2015, Warne had already dropped a hint to NDTVsports? 

"I miss being part of the IPL. I had made some great friendships. The atmosphere was great and the Indian support was brilliant. It's an amazing tournament and it allows you to share knowledge with different players. Maybe I will be back with the Royals or somebody else in the future." 

Furthermore, in 2017, it was also reported that the Rajasthan Royals' think-tank got in touch the great Aussie to mentor the team for the 11th edition of the IPL. While the above lines indicate the inevitable, we highlight a few more reasons as to why the 'Spin King' will oversee proceedings in the Royals' camp. 

Emotional connect with RR 

From the time Warne skippered the Royals to the title in 2008, he has become emotionally connected to the Rajasthan franchise. In fact, he was also seen as a mentor by several young cricketers. From the players, owners, support staff to the fans, Warne was a hero! Over the years, very few overseas professionals could manage to generate a massive fan following in India, but Warne's success and approach towards the league saw his fanfare and adulation reach new highs in our country. Much like Sachin Tendulkar is to Mumbai and MS Dhoni is to Chennai, Warne too has a similar connect with Rajasthan. 

Healthy rapport with RR owners  

As mentioned above, the Rajasthan management have already shown intent in absorbing Warne to their support staff. As we have seen in the IPL, the coach/Mentor needs to have a decent rapport with the working committee of the franchise. Otherwise, plans can go completely awry. RR think-tank have always believed in nurturing young talent and Warne too has publicly endorsed similar belief ever since the ball was set rolling in the IPL. Yusuf Pathan, Ravindra Jadeja and Shane Watson all benefited under the watchful eyes of Warne. Given Warne's man-management skills and his ability to bring the best out from his troops, it all looks very promising. 

Steve Smith Factor 

Lately, Warne has been heaping plenty of praises on his countryman, Steve Smith. We all know the Aussie star batsman is going to lead the Royals and it is only logical to hire a coach-cum-mentor who has a great relationship with the skipper. For eg: MS Dhoni-Stephen Flemming or Virat Kohli-Daniel Vettori. Both Smith and Warne believe in being aggressive and have the tendency to challenge conventional thinking. Both also share tremendous respect for each other and that will only keep the Royals in good stead. 

Fan Base 

The Royals are coming back to the IPL after serving a two-year ban. Moreover, there is no clarity on whether they will play their home matches at Jaipur. Given their slightly tainted impression and limited home fan-following, it is imperative for the franchise to rope in someone who is capable of attracting the fans back. Warne's charisma and refreshing attitude will certainly go a long way in re-establishing the fan connect towards the Royals. 

Any moment, Warne is going to make it official. While it may be premature to predict the RR's outcome for the forthcoming season, there is no risk in stating that, the 2008 champs have started off their resurrection on a best possible note.
